The financial group Charm accelerates on the enhancement of Flakes Ammunition, historical Italian company founded in 1861 and world leader in the production of ammunition of any type and caliber for civil use. According to rumors, the investment company headed by the Montezemolo family and among whose partners there is Luigi Sala, would have entrusted the tasks to the investment banks in charge of evaluating the different valuation options: a mandate would in fact be entrusted to the American Citi and Lazard. Fiocchi Munizioni could be of interest to strategic groups active in the same sector: among the circulating names of potential interested there are those of some American groups.
But one of the options could also be a quote always overseas, perhaps through a US Spac. Less interest should instead come from private equity funds, which especially in the last two years must strictly comply with ESG regulations, that is on social, environmental and corporate governance issues. After all, the United States is now one of the main markets of the Italian company: of the 280 million turnover expected at the end of 2021, about half is in fact generated overseas. In 2018, the Charme fund took over 60 per cent of the Fiocchi group, while the family had reinvested the remaining 40 per cent (The Sun 24 hours).
